Discover why this family-friendly winter resort located just 10 minutes from Bottineau has been dubbed "The Jewel Above the Prairie". We're in the heart of North Dakota's Turtle Mountains, and once you enter the Turtle Mountains, you're in the center of snow fun.

 

Bottineau Winter Park sits in the heart of North Dakota's snowbelt, We get the best and most snow that Mother Nature has to offer. But that isn't good enough for us. We want to ensure the best possible snow conditions from opening day until the season ends. Snowmaking machines  produce snow over 100% of the area! - Including the tubing hill and XTreme areas.

 

We have something for everyone. Enjoy your day skiing or snowboarding on a wide variety of terrain from the beginner's Southside area to ungroomed expert glade runs and race courses, with skiing and riding for all abilities at very affordable prices. Five lifts will speed you to the top to choose from 9 trails while you take in the views of the Turtle Mountain Region.

 

When you're ready for a break from the slopes, visit Bottineau Winter Park's Chalet where you will find a full service cafeteria.  You may also enjoy sitting outdoors on the adjoining observation deck with your refreshment.

If you are not ready to ski or snowboard, nothing is as easy and fun as sliding down our snow tubing hill or you may want to try the cross-country loop through the woods. Bottineau Winter Park has all the amenities, including full rentals and expert instruction in the latest techniques for alpine skiing and snowboarding, a base lodge and restaurant.

Construction begins on “Annie’s House”, an adaptive ski facility at Bottineau Winter Park. Groundbreaking Ceremony May 17 11am at Bottineau Winter Park.  To read the full press release click here


 


 

New York Says Thank You Foundation

One the Nation’s leading volunteer organizations focused on the 9/11 Anniversary, is partnering with The Bottineau Winter Park in Bottineau, ND to help build Annie’s House at Bottineau Winter Park.

Creating North Dakota’s first adaptive ski facility to teach disabled children, young adults, and wounded warriors how to ski. while also providing a year-round facility to accommodate other adaptive sports in honor of Ann Nelson a resident of Stanley, North Dakota who was the only North Dakota resident to perish in the World Trade Center attacks in New York City on 9/11.
